How to Make Fudgy Cottage Cheese Protein Brownies
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:
Step 1: Preheat the Oven
Start by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ease an 8×8-inch baking pan with nonstick spray or line it with parchment paper for easy removal after baking.
Step 2: Blend Cottage Cheese
In a blender or food processor, combine the cottage cheese and eggs until smooth. This will create a creamy base that helps keep your brownies moist.
Step 3: Mix Dry Ingredients
In a large mixing bowl, whisk together almond flour, cocoa powder, and baking powder. Make sure there are no lumps—unless you’re looking for brownie “surprises,” which I don’t recommend!
Step 4: Combine Wet Ingredients
Add the blended cottage cheese mixture and maple syrup to the dry ingredients. Stir until everything is well combined—your arm might get a workout here!
Step 5: Pour Into Pan
Transfer the brownie batter into your prepared baking pan, smoothing it out evenly with a spatula. Don’t worry if it looks thick; that’s just how we like our fudgy brownies!
Step 6: Bake and Cool
Bake in the preheated oven for about 20-25 minutes or until set but still slightly soft in the middle. Allow them to cool completely before slicing into squares—if you can resist temptation that long.

Storing & Reheating
Store leftover brownies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to three days or refrigerate them for up to a week. For reheating, pop them in the microwave for about 10-15 seconds to regain that fudgy texture.

How do I store Fudgy Cottage Cheese Protein Brownies?
To keep your Fudgy Cottage Cheese Protein Brownies fresh, store them in an airtight container at room temperature for up to three days. If you want them to last longer, refrigerate them for up to a week. You can also freeze these brownies for up to three months. Just make sure to wrap them tightly in plastic wrap or use a freezer-safe container to prevent freezer burn.

Fudgy Cottage Cheese Protein Brownies
- Total Time: 35 minutes
- Yield: 12 servings 1x
Description
Fudgy Cottage Cheese Protein Brownies are your go-to guilt-free dessert that seamlessly combines rich chocolate flavor with a protein-packed boost. Made with creamy cottage cheese, these brownies not only satisfy your sweet cravings but also support your health goals. Perfect for any occasion, enjoy these fudgy delights as an afternoon snack or a post-workout treat that everyone will love.
Ingredients
- 1 cup low-fat cottage cheese
- 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1/2 cup almond flour
- 1/3 cup pure maple syrup
- 2 large eggs
- 1 tsp baking powder
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ease an 8×8-inch baking pan or line it with parchment paper.
- In a blender, blend cottage cheese and eggs until smooth.
- In a bowl, whisk together almond flour, cocoa powder, and baking powder until no lumps remain.
- Combine the wet mixture with the dry ingredients and stir until well mixed.
- Pour the batter into the prepared pan, smoothing it evenly.
- Bake for 20-25 minutes until set but slightly soft in the center. Cool completely before slicing.
